If your hair is prone to dryness, it also likely tends toward dullness and breakage. Avocados aren’t just yummy, they’re also full of vitamins and proteins that are great for your hair. To make, mash together an extremely ripe avocado, 2-3 tablespoons of olive oil, and 2 tablespoons of honey. Keep on mixing ’til there aren’t any lumps, then use a wide-toothed comb to spread it through your dry tresses. Wait minutes, then hop in the shower as per normal. Who doesn’t want to have smooth and silky hair? With tons of problems and pollutants that affect our hair, following a proper hair care routine can become a constant struggle. You can get smooth hair by putting in some effort in using affordable home remedies without having to spend too much money. Mash a banana, add some honey, 1/2 cup of yoghurt and two tablespoons of olive oil. Apply this on your hair and wrap a towel around it for an hour or so. Wash your hair with water and let it dry naturally.
